Many birders have supported the campaign to protect the 200ha Yandina Creek Wetland on Queensland’s Sunshine Coast, which had provided refuge to hundreds of migratory shorebirds and other waterbirds. The wetland has been drained for the second time as government departments pass the buck on who can do what.
